| | depending what TV Tuner Card you have, i believe that your tv tuner card cant use your laptop monitor as it will only outputs signal. your laptops vga also only outputs signal. you can use your laptop as tv if you buy a USB type tv tuner, connect it to usb, install driver and your ready to go. | | | | | | |
